How to write the name Katsurou in Japanese?

The name “Katsurou” can be written in Japanese using kanji characters as “勝郎”. Here, “勝” means “victory” or “win”, and “郎” is a common suffix for male names, indicating a son or young man. So, “Katsurou” can be interpreted as something like “victorious son” or “young man of victory”.
